Fun Facts About Johnson County, WY
- County Seat: Buffalo
- Year Established: 1875
- Formed from: Parts of Carbon County and Sweetwater County.
- Etymology: E.P. Johnson, a lawyer from Cheyenne, Wyoming.
- Time Zone: America/Denver
- Population: 8615
- Land Area Sq Km: 10790
- Land Area Sq Mi: 4166
- Density: 2.1
